Preparation Time

  • Preparation time: 10 minutes
  • Cooking time: 20-30 minutes
  • Total time: 30-40 minutes
  • Suits: 4-6 people
  • Difficulty: Medium

The necessary ingredients

Gather these delightful ingredients to create your luscious dish:

  • 12 ounces of pasta (fettuccine or penne works beautifully)
  • 16 ounces of cream cheese, softened
  • 1 cup of heavy cream
  • 2 cups of fresh cherry tomatoes, halved
  • 1 cup of fresh basil leaves, chopped
  • 2 cloves of garlic, minced
  • 1 teaspoon of salt
  • 1 teaspoon of black pepper
  • 1 tablespoon of olive oil
  • For a Vegan Version: Use cashew cream or silken tofu instead of cream cheese and heavy cream, and choose whole grain or gluten-free pasta.
  • For Gluten-Free Options: Any gluten-free pasta can be swapped in to ensure everyone can enjoy this dish!

The steps of preparation

Let’s dive into the culinary adventure that awaits you. These steps are designed to guide you smoothly through the creation of this delightful dish:

  1. Begin by boiling a large pot of salted water. Once boiling, add the pasta and cook according to the package instructions until al dente.
  2. While the pasta cooks, heat olive oil in a large skillet over medium heat.
  3. Add the minced garlic to the skillet and sauté for about 1 minute until fragrant, but not browned.
  4. Mix in the halved cherry tomatoes and cook until they start to soften, about 3-5 minutes.
  5. In a mixing bowl, combine the softened cream cheese and heavy cream, whisking until smooth and creamy.
  6. Add salt and pepper to the cream cheese mixture and stir well to incorporate.
  7. Once the pasta is cooked, reserve a cup of pasta water, then drain the pasta and add it directly to the skillet with the tomatoes and garlic.
  8. Pour the cream cheese mixture over the pasta and toss everything together, adding reserved pasta water a little at a time until reaching your desired creamy consistency.
  9. Finally, fold in the fresh basil leaves, tossing gently to combine.
  10. Serve hot, topped with extra basil and a drizzle of olive oil if desired.

Q&A

**Can I make this recipe ahead of time?**
Yes, you can prepare the ingredients and cook the pasta ahead of time. Just combine everything right before serving to keep it fresh.

**Is this dish kid-friendly?**
Absolutely! The creamy texture and mild flavors of tomatoes are sure to please even the pickiest eaters.

**What if I don’t have fresh basil?**
While fresh basil adds a unique flavor, you can substitute with dried basil, though you should use half the amount.

**Can I use low-fat cream cheese?**
Yes, low-fat cream cheese can be used, but it may affect the overall creaminess of the dish.

**Is there a faster way to prepare this?**
Using a pressure cooker like an Instant Pot can speed up the process by cooking the pasta and sauce together.

**Can I freeze leftovers?**
Yes, this pasta can be frozen, but the texture may change when reheated.

**How can I make this dish spicier?**
Add red pepper flakes or diced jalapeños for a spicy kick!

**What side dishes pair well with this pasta?**
A simple side salad or garlic bread pairs beautifully!

**How do I store leftovers?**
Store any leftovers in an airtight container in the fridge for up to 3 days.

**Can I use other types of pasta?**
Definitely! Any pasta shape will work, so feel free to use your favorite variety.
